The Physical Therapist plans and provides physical therapy services to the clients in their home in accordance with the Plan of Care and the company's policies and procedures. The Physical Therapist performs functions which require substantial specialized knowledge, judgement and skill based upon the principles of psychological, biological and social services and must be able to make judgements accordingly. The Physical Therapist reports directly to the Clinical Supervisor.

SCHEDULE

• This is a full time or part time position with a flexible schedule during office hours Monday - Friday.

• This position will require you to travel to client's homes to provide 1:1 client care that may take 1-3 hours per client.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ES

• Administers physical therapy evaluations. Participates in the development of the Plan of Care.

• Provides physical therapy treatments, procedures, evaluations and diagnostic tests for clients under the direction of their physician for whom therapy has been medically prescribed.

• Translates all exercises into functional activities or activities of daily living.

• Provides instructions in the use and care of assistive devices.

• Develops needed plans for modifying equipment, appliances and the physical surroundings in client's homes.

• Prepares clinical and progress notes. Reports to physician and the Case Manager the client's response to treatment or change in condition.

• Maintains appropriate records including frequency of visits and client's response.

• Instructs and supervises PTAs, and HHAs when appropriate.

• Provides in-service education programs for company staff as requested.

• Participates in Case Conferences as indicated.

• Provides families with information, support and encouragement to help motivate clients in their progress. Instructs client's family on home physical therapy program.

• Assists individuals and families to accept and adjust positively to physical, mental and social limitations.

• Participates in the development of community resources to meet the needs of clients.

• Maintains positive and effective communication with all staff and others. Understands and participates in team concept.

• Maintains absolute confidentiality of all information pertaining to clients, families and employees.

• Maintains a safe client environment and identifies and reports to the office any suspected vulnerable client abuse, neglect, or financial exploitation.

• Performs other related duties and responsibilities as assigned.

PHYSICAL/ENVIRONMENTAL DEMANDS
Heavy to Very Heavy. Involves lifting clients, bending, stooping, stretching, and setting up equipment. Must be adaptable to a variety of environments and community settings. Must be able to drive or use public transportation in all types of weather.

Exerting in excess of 100 pounds of force occasionally, in excess of 50 pounds of force frequently, and in excess of 20 pounds of force constantly to move objects. Physical demand requirements are in excess of those for heavy work.

QUALIFICATIONS

• Graduate of an accredited Physical Therapy program; currently licensed as a Physical Therapist in the state of Minnesota. The license must not have been revoked, suspended, and without limitations or restrictions.

• Have at least two (2) years experience in a health care setting or equivalent experience. Home care experience preferred.

• Strong interpersonal communication and teaching skills.

• Strong organizational skills and the ability to work independently.

• Excellent written and oral communication skills.

• Access to a dependable vehicle or public transportation in order to travel to multiple company business stops a day.

• A valid driver's license and proof of car insurance when using a personal vehicle for company business.

• Proof of negative mantoux or documentation of negative chest x-ray.

• Current CPR certification is highly recommended.

• Have U.S. Citizenship or evidence of valid Alien Work Permit.

• Discloses any conviction and criminal history records pertaining to any crime related to the provision of health services. A candidate who has been convicted of such crimes will not be hired.

• Pass initial and ongoing background studies and screenings including but not limited to those of the Minnesota Department of Health and the Federal Office of the Inspector General's List of Excluded Individuals and Entities.
